Text
(a)As used in this section, "dormant captive insurance company" means a pure captive insurance company, sponsored captive insurance company, or industrial insured captive insurance company that has:
(1)Ceased transacting the business of insurance, including the issuance of insurance policies; and (2) No remaining liabilities associated with insurance business transactions, or insurance policies issued before the filing of its application for a certificate of dormancy under this section.
(b)(1) A captive insurance company domiciled in this state that meets the criteria of subsection (a) of this section may apply to the Insurance Commissioner for a certificate of dormancy.
